Where the Wild Things Are is a beloved children's picture book that invites kids and families into a bold, imaginative adventure. Crafted by Maurice Sendak, this story blends concise, lyrical text with striking illustrations and features the iconic moment when Max proclaims the wild rumpus.

  • Format: Picture book with bold, expressive illustrations that vividly bring Max’s island journey to life
  • Author: Maurice Sendak, renowned for concise storytelling paired with evocative artwork
  • Core themes: Imagination, emotions, independence, and belonging explored through Max’s voyage
  • Audience & Use: Ideal for families, read-aloud sessions, and classroom libraries seeking engaging storytelling
  • Illustration style: High-contrast, dynamic artwork that captivates young readers and supports language development

This book helps children navigate big feelings in a safe, imaginative setting. By following Max from mischief to discovery, readers practice emotional literacy, empathy, and the idea that imagination can be a constructive path for processing emotions. It also provides a natural entry point for conversations about self-control, forgiveness, and the importance of returning home after an adventure. The story’s rhythm and visuals make it a reliable, engaging option for bedtime, storytime, or group reading.
